Solar activity is beginning to spark up a bit. Sunspot region 913 kicked up a low level CME (coronal mass ejection) setting off a moderate geomagnetic storm. Interesting to note it is only three weeks into the new cycle and already see solar activity one would see at the end of the first year.

NASA scientist Dr. Mausumi Dikpati, predicted Cycle 24 will be 50% stronger than its predecessor. The current solar cycle will begin to ramp-up in 2007 hitting its "apex" (maximum) in 2011/2012. Hmmm, just at the time the Mayan Calendar ends---
